Chilean Public Procurement Platform whistleblower system

This online platform allows citizens to make complaints and report cases of inappropriate payments or corruption related to the public procurement processes published on the website.

Online reporting of corruption and wrongdoing

On this portal, citizens can fill out an online application form to report corruption and wrongdoing, which is then investigated by the Corruption Prevention and Combating Bureau.
